diff --git a/www/docs/images/mysociety-team.webp b/www/docs/images/mysociety-team.webp new file mode 100644 index 0000000000..c6f24556c7 Binary files /dev/null and b/www/docs/images/mysociety-team.webp differ diff --git a/www/docs/style/img/logo-mysociety-black.svg b/www/docs/style/img/logo-mysociety-black.svg new file mode 100644 index 0000000000..dd201a9915 --- /dev/null +++ b/www/docs/style/img/logo-mysociety-black.svg @@ -0,0 +1,10 @@ + diff --git a/www/docs/style/sass/pages/_about.scss b/www/docs/style/sass/pages/_about.scss index 589e870d49..681fdf0837 100644 --- a/www/docs/style/sass/pages/_about.scss +++ b/www/docs/style/sass/pages/_about.scss @@ -1,7 +1,7 @@ .about-page { hr { max-width: none !important; - margin: 3em 0; + margin: 2em 0; } h2 { @@ -9,6 +9,51 @@ } } +.about-section { + @include grid-row(collapse); + + margin-bottom: 2em; + border-radius: 3px; + background-color: white; +} + +.about-section__primary { + @include grid-column(12, $collapse: true); + padding: 1em; + border-bottom: 1px solid $colour_off_white; + + @media (min-width: $medium-screen) { + padding: 2.5em 3em; + } + + @media (min-width: $large-screen) { + @include grid-column(8, $collapse: true); + padding: 2.5em 3em; + border-bottom: none; + border-right: 1px solid $colour_off_white; + } +} + +.about-section__secondary { + @include grid-column(12, $collapse: true); + padding: 1.5em; + + @media (min-width: $medium-screen) { + padding: 2.5em 2em; + } + + @media (min-width: $large-screen) { + @include grid-column(4, $collapse: true); + padding: 2.5em 2em; + } + + a { + word-break: normal; + overflow-wrap: normal; + hyphens: none; + } +} + .about-page__features { @include clearfix(); list-style: none; @@ -32,12 +77,6 @@ } } -.about-page__mysociety { - background: #fff url(../img/about-team-patchwork.jpg) 0 0 no-repeat; - background-size: 100%; - padding-top: 24%; -} - .about-page__donate { display: inline-block; max-width: none !important; diff --git a/www/includes/easyparliament/templates/html/static/_newsletter.php b/www/includes/easyparliament/templates/html/static/_newsletter.php new file mode 100644 index 0000000000..d676e49a54 --- /dev/null +++ b/www/includes/easyparliament/templates/html/static/_newsletter.php @@ -0,0 +1,33 @@ +
= gettext('TheyWorkForYou is run by mySociety, a UK charity that helps people access information and participate in democracy. We enable people across the UK to become changemakers by providing technology, research and data, openly and for free.') ?>
+= gettext('Through TheyWorkForYou and WriteToThem we have made elected representatives more transparent and contactable. Every year, hundreds of thousands of reports are made through FixMyStreet, and over a million Freedom of Information requests have been made through WhatDoTheyKnow.') ?>
+ += gettext('Find out more about how mySociety is funded.') ?>
diff --git a/www/includes/easyparliament/templates/html/static/about.php b/www/includes/easyparliament/templates/html/static/about.php index f7e748d871..02baf6b96e 100644 --- a/www/includes/easyparliament/templates/html/static/about.php +++ b/www/includes/easyparliament/templates/html/static/about.php @@ -1,118 +1,84 @@
+ = gettext('TheyWorkForYou was founded twenty years ago to make Parliament more accessible and accountable.') ?>
+= gettext('TheyWorkForYou was founded twenty years ago to make Parliament more accessible and accountable.') ?>
-= gettext('We believe that information about our elected representatives should be easily understandable and accessible to everyone, and not just insiders or those who can pay.') ?>
+= gettext('We believe that information about our elected representatives should be easily understandable and accessible to everyone, and not just insiders or those who can pay.') ?>
-= gettext("We now work across the UK's Parliaments to bring information together in one place, and make it accessible to both citizens and to civil society.") ?>
+= gettext("We now work across the UK's Parliaments to bring information together in one place, and make it accessible to both citizens and to civil society.") ?>
-= gettext('Through TheyWorkForYou and WriteToThem, we want to make it easy to understand what the UK\'s - different layers of representation do, and make the actions of our - representatives and governments more transparent.') ?>
+= gettext('Through TheyWorkForYou and WriteToThem, we want to make it easy to understand what the UK\'s + different layers of representation do, and make the actions of our + representatives and governments more transparent.') ?>
-= gettext('We do this by:') ?>
+= gettext('We do this by:') ?>
-= gettext('If you support TheyWorkForYou\'s goals, you can help us do more by making a donation.') ?>
- -= gettext('For more information about how we run the site, please read our FAQs.') ?>
+= gettext('If you support TheyWorkForYou\'s goals, you can help us do more by making a donation.') ?>
+= gettext('For more information about how we run the site, please read our FAQs.') ?>
+= gettext('TheyWorkForYou is run by mySociety, a UK charity that helps people access information and participate in democracy. We enable people across the UK to become changemakers by providing technology, research and data, openly and for free.') ?>
-= gettext('Through TheyWorkForYou and WriteToThem we have made elected representatives more transparent and contactable. Every year, hundreds of thousands of reports are made through FixMyStreet, and over a million Freedom of Information requests have been made through WhatDoTheyKnow.') ?>
- -= gettext('Find out more about how mySociety is funded.') ?>
- - - - -= gettext('Many thanks to mySociety team members and volunteers alike, past and present, for their work on TheyWorkForYou. Including:') ?>
- -= gettext('The copyright of Hansard remains under Parliamentary Copyright, used under licence. ') ?>
- += gettext('Many thanks to mySociety team members and volunteers alike, past and present, for their work on TheyWorkForYou. Including:') ?>
+ += gettext('The copyright of Hansard remains under Parliamentary Copyright, used under licence. ') ?>
+